Source / Purification

The GST-Kinase fusion protein was produced using a baculovirus expression system with a construct expressing human HER2/ErbB2 (Lys676-Val1255) (GenBank Accession No. NM_004448) with an amino-terminal GST tag. The protein was purified by one-step affinity chromatography using glutathione-agarose.

Description

Purified recombinant human HER2/ErbB2 (Lys676-Val1255) kinase, supplied as a GST fusion protein.

Quality Control

The theoretical molecular weight of the GST-HER2/ErbB2 fusion protein is 116 kDa. The purified kinase was quality controlled for purity using SDS-PAGE followed by Coomassie stain [Fig.1]. HER2/ErbB2 kinase activity was determined using a radiometric assay [Fig.2].

Kinase Assay - Radiometric

Kinase Assay - Radiometric

Figure 2. HER2/ErbB2 kinase activity was measured in a radiometric assay using the following reaction conditions: 5 mM MOPS, pH 7.2, 2.5 mM β-glycerophosphate, 5 mM MnCl2, 1 mM EGTA, 0.4 mM EDTA, 4 mM MgCl2, 0.05 mM DTT, 50 μM ATP, Substrate: Poly(Glu-Tyr), 400 ng/μL, and recombinant HER2/ErbB2: variable.

Background

The ErbB2 (HER2) proto-oncogene encodes a 185 kDa transmembrane, receptor-like glycoprotein with intrinsic tyrosine kinase activity (1). While ErbB2 lacks an identified ligand, ErbB2 kinase activity can be activated in the absence of a ligand when overexpressed and through heteromeric associations with other ErbB family members (2). Amplification of the ErbB2 gene and overexpression of its product are detected in almost 40% of human breast cancers (3). Binding of the c-Cbl ubiquitin ligase to ErbB2 at Tyr1112 leads to ErbB2 poly-ubiquitination and enhances degradation of this kinase (4). ErbB2 is a key therapeutic target in the treatment of breast cancer and other carcinomas and targeting the regulation of ErbB2 degradation by the c-Cbl-regulated proteolytic pathway is one potential therapeutic strategy. Phosphorylation of the kinase domain residue Tyr877 of ErbB2 (homologous to Tyr416 of pp60c-Src) may be involved in regulating ErbB2 biological activity. The major autophosphorylation sites in ErbB2 are Tyr1248 and Tyr1221/1222; phosphorylation of these sites couples ErbB2 to the Ras-Raf-MAP kinase signal transduction pathway (1,5).
